Revival is Coming!

For thus saith the high and lofty One that inhabiteth eternity, whose name is Holy; I dwell in the high and holy place, with him also that is of a contrite and humble spirit, to revive the spirit of the humble, and to revive the heart of the contrite ones. —Isaiah 57:15
The other day I went to see one of our daughters. She lives in a quaint cabin at the end of a lane in the country. After our visit, walking back to get into my truck, something crunched under my feet—walnut hulls. The first thing I thought of was squirrels and all the food they had for the upcoming winter.
After driving off, I began to look around. Then it dawned on me what was really going on. All around me, foliage has begun to fall off of the trees. We are entering a dormant season. This time of brown grass and bare trees allows us to know that winter is just ahead.
While we see the dormancy that is coming on, that is not what the tree sees. You see: The reason that tree was dropping nuts, seed, or fruit is because it is preparing for the revival to come in four to five months. God put it in that tree—no matter what is happening around it—to know revival is coming.
Why did we give up so easily? When did we decide revival, life, regeneration, and renewal had stopped? It may look like everything around you is dying, but stay humble and keep pursuing a change, a turnaround. For He who is High and Holy said He would revive the spirit of the humble. No matter who tells you to give up, be like the walnut tree by the little cabin. Keep producing, because life will come again.
Our prayer for you this week: May you never allow anything or anyone to affect your future. Keep producing. Revival is coming.
